Breast Cancer often has a positive outcome when compared to other cancers. These outcomes are even further improved when it is detected early. Now, there are some breast cancers that arise so quickly early detection is not possible…or is it?
There are two genes that have been attributed to increased susceptibility to Breast Cancer. These genes are BRCA1 and BRCA2 (pronounced Bracka 1 and Bracka 2). These genes are tumor suppressor genes with similar function. The normal function of these genes is to repair naturally occurring DNA variations.
Scientists have identified over 600 variations to BRCA1 and over 400 variations to BRCA2. What th1s means is that variations of these genes can lead to increased chance of getting breast cancer. Remember, variation in the BRCA genes does not mean cancer, it just means h1gher chance.

Also, if there is an evident family h1story, ask them to talk to their family doctor about getting a genetic test. The BRCA1 and BRCA2 gene locations are known; the types of variations are known; and these mean the test is very useful in predicting predisposition.
If a variation is found, then your friends will have early notice to become stricter with their self-exams and other, clinically-based breast exams such as mammograms. Prognosis improves with early detection. If you can tell your friends that they can help by getting checked themselves, you may have saved them the trials you are facing.
